支持vaapi、支持定义使用哪种弹幕转换工具

This commit is contained in:
2022-10-10 14:35:28 +08:00
parent 7dbf9822c9
commit b74c6f0ef7
5 changed files with 98 additions and 18 deletions

View File

@ -84,6 +84,10 @@
<td>HEVC</td>
<td :class="{warning: !config.ffmpeg.hevc, success: config.ffmpeg.hevc}"></td>
</tr>
<tr>
<td>VAAPI</td>
<td :class="{warning: !config.ffmpeg.vaapi, success: config.ffmpeg.vaapi}"></td>
</tr>
<tr>
<td>嘤伟达GPU</td>
<td :class="{warning: !config.ffmpeg.nvidia_gpu, success: config.ffmpeg.nvidia_gpu}"></td>
@ -117,6 +121,14 @@
<td>命令</td>
<td>{{ config.danmaku.exec }}</td>
</tr>
<tr>
<td>DANMU2ASS</td>
<td :class="{warning: !config.danmaku.use_danmu2ass, success: config.danmaku.use_danmu2ass}"></td>
</tr>
<tr>
<td>DanmakuFactory</td>
<td :class="{warning: !config.danmaku.use_danmakufactory, success: config.danmaku.use_danmakufactory}"></td>
</tr>
<tr>
<td>滚动速度</td>
<td>{{ config.danmaku.speed }}</td>
@ -285,6 +297,8 @@
config: {
danmaku: {
exec: "",
use_danmu2ass: false,
use_danmakufactory: false,
speed: 0,
font: "",
font_size: 0,
@ -306,6 +320,7 @@
hevc: false,
nvidia_gpu: false,
intel_gpu: false,
vaapi: false,
bitrate: "",
crf: "",
gop: "",